At present, lasers are usually used to cut battery cells. However, the intensity and density of the laser are different, and the degree of damage to the battery cells is different. In severe cases, the leakage current of the cut battery cells is too large, causing widespread harm.
Laser cutting is the most widely used laser processing technology. Its principle is that the laser is focused and irradiated onto the material, causing the temperature of the material to rise sharply to melt or vaporize. With the relative movement of the laser and the material being cut, the material is cut. A slit is formed on the material to achieve the purpose of cutting.
Laser cutting occupies a large proportion in laser processing applications (currently laser cutting accounts for more than 70% of laser processing), and its application in the photovoltaic industry is becoming more and more widespread. Compared with traditional cutting methods, laser cutting has incomparable advantages, mainly in:
①. High cutting precision, narrow slit, good quality, small heat-affected zone, and the cutting end face is flat and smooth;
②. Fast cutting speed and high processing efficiency;
③. It is a non-contact cutting. It has no mechanical processing force, no deformation, and no pollution problems such as processing chips, oil stains, noise, etc. It is a green and environmentally friendly processing;
④. Strong cutting ability, can cut almost any material.
However, laser cutting of battery cells also has some disadvantages, mainly reflected in:
① When the laser is cutting, it will cause certain damage to the crystal phase of the battery cells, which will cause damage and cracks to a certain extent;
②. After the crystal phase of the cell is damaged, the solar module produced will have the risk of leakage during operation. This article mainly uses experiments to verify the impact of laser intensity and density on solar cells during laser cutting.
